Title: Prohibits Vaccination of New Foster Children

Vote Smart's Synopsis:

Vote to pass a bill that prohibits the vaccination of children new to the foster care system, among other provisions.

Highlights:

  • Specifies that a child taken into the conservatorship of the Department of Family and Protective Services who remains in conservatorship for more than 3 business days must receive a medical examination and a mental health screening from a physician or other healthcare provider (Sec. 4).

  • Prohibits a physician or healthcare provider from administering vaccines to a child in the course of such examination (Sec. 4).

  • Specifies that a physician or healthcare provider may administer a tetanus vaccines to a child in the course of such examination if the physician determines that there is an emergency that necessitates the vaccines (Sec. 4).

  • Specifies that this prohibition no longer applies after the Department has been named managing conservator of a child in a hearing (Sec. 4).

  • Authorizes additional changes to the foster care system, effective September 1, 2017 (Secs. 1-3, 5-24).
